Decameron Getaway

Elizabeth and I visited the Decameron Resort for a short break. We were there from Sunday to Tuesday and had a great time.

After arriving on Sunday, we went swimming. Elizabeth enjoyed the ocean while I relaxed by the pool. The resort had five swimming pools to choose from. We took a break before heading to dinner at one of the six restaurants on the resort: Salvadorian, Seafood, Steakhouse, Italian, and International. Snacks like hamburgers, hot dogs, and sandwiches were available between meals.

On Sunday evening, we had a delightful salmon dinner and then enjoyed some drinks at one of the resort’s bars.

We both had a lovely breakfast on Monday and spent the day swimming and exploring the resort. In the evening, we had a delicious beef tenderloin dinner.

We slept in on Tuesday, packed up, had lunch, and checked out at 1 PM.

I highly recommend the Decameron Resort to anyone visiting El Salvador. It’s an all-inclusive resort, and we had a fantastic time. We’ve also compiled a slideshow of our stay, which we hope you’ll enjoy.
